We send our data in realtime to the cloud, so we can instantly route relevant conversations to the appropriate medium (apps, mobile browsing, desktops, SMS, voice etc) and combine them where necessary. Everything is connected. We now have massive opportunities to interact with huge audiences at scale, for those that can leverage the technology. In this talk, Phil will briefly cover some of the core realtime web technologies that are contributing to this and then, using Twilio and Pusher, he'll explore and demonstrate the communications benefits that realtime web technologies offer. A Brief History of Communication

Grunts & Gestures (sometime B.C)

Visual or Audio ­ drums, smoke signals, light signals (after 13,000 B.C)

Long distance semaphore, electric telegraph, morse code (1793)

Long distance electric telegraph (1831)

Radio Signals (1902)

TV Signals (1925)

These were not available to the masses

Often one­to­one communication

Other communcation mediums were one way or fire & forget

* A history with a focus on realtime* By realtime I mean where interactions can take place* A message can be instantly responded to.* Think of this as synchronous communication rather than asynchronous* Even some of the potentially synchronous communication mediums were difficult* And required reasonably close proximity* And they were often one­to­one communication* And frequently not available to the masses* Other communication mediums where much more asynchronous ­ fire and forget* e.g. carrier pigeons, letters Interaction could take hours, days weeks.

Opportunity

Timely/Realtime data delivery

The opportunity to be the destination for the most up to date informationLive content

Live events

Give your customers opportunity to act on the latest information

The opportunity to build exciting experiences

* The timely nature of the delivery of information provides the receiver of that information with opportunity to act upon it.* The technology was initially developed and targeted at financial organisations. The sooner the users of these applications had data on stock and share prices the sooner they could make a decision. It gave them the opportunity to act.* ITV updated their site to focus on an activity stream of news. This has increased their site traffic 10 fold.* Or the person who can deliver the information instantly has the ability to create opportunity

Text 2 Win ­ walkthrough

* Twilio uses WebHooks ­ a call over HTTP.* Pusher maintains a persistent connection between the client and Pusher so any new information can be instantly delivered to the client.
